An extension of time is a provision in construction contracts allowing the project completion date to be adjusted due to legitimate delays. Without it, contractors might face penalties for delays beyond their control. EOT is not just about buying time. It's also about fairness.

What does Extension of time mean? A mechanism by which a contractor requests a longer period than had been contractually agreed in order to complete the building works. A contractor will usually make a request for an extension of time and give reasons for it.
